GRILLED BURGERS
Provided by Food Network Kitchen
Time 25m
Yield 4 servings
Number Of Ingredients 5
Steps:
- Preheat a grill to medium high. Divide the beef into four 6-ounce portions. Gather each into a ball, then gently flatten into a 4 1/2-inch-wide patty about 3/4 inch thick. Press your thumb into the center of each patty to make a 1/2-inch-deep indentation (this prevents the patties from bulging as they cook). Season the patties on both sides with salt and pepper.
- Lightly brush the grill grates with vegetable oil, then grill the patties indentation-side up until marked on the bottom, about 5 minutes. Flip and cook until marked and slightly firm, about 3 more minutes for medium doneness.
- Remove the burgers to a plate and let rest 5 minutes so the juices redistribute. Serve the burgers on the buns; top as desired.
GRILLED HAMBURGERS
We cook a lot of burgers indoors on a fat-slicked iron skillet, and you can do that on a grill as well. (Here's our burger guide for more information and inspiration.) But sometimes you want a smoky grilled burger. For that, a charcoal grill is best, but a gas grill can do the trick, too. Resist the temptation to press down on the burgers with a spatula, which only spews juice and fat on the fire, causing the flames to flare up and the burger to lose flavor. If you feel your burger is cooking too quickly, use the cooler sides of the grill to rest them. And remember: lowering the top on the grill helps cheese melt.

HOW TO GRILL THE BEST BURGERS | ALLRECIPES
From allrecipes.com
Estimated Reading Time 4 mins
- Fat = Flavor. Use beef that is no leaner than 85 percent. Meat with a higher fat content will be juicier and more flavorful. But be aware, patties from higher fat meat will shrink more when they cook.
- Build Additional Flavor. Add just about anything you like to your burger mixture. Here are a few flavoring suggestions: Fresh or dried herbs and spices.
- Hold the Salt! Don't combine salt into the mixture, especially if you're not going to grill the patties right away. Salt will extract moisture from the meat, leaving you with dry burgers.
- Don't Mix Too Much. Use a light touch when combining seasonings with the ground beef. If you mix it too much, your burgers will be dense and heavy.
- Let the Flavors Mingle. Leave the meat mixture (or patties) in the refrigerator for several hours to allow all the flavors to mingle. To form patties, wet your hands a little to keep the meat from sticking to them.
- Form a Good Patty. Don't form patties too thick or too thin. A 3/4-inch thick patty is ideal. To keep patties from swelling in the middle, make small indentations in the center.
- Temperature Matters. Make sure the grill is the appropriate temperature. Medium-low to medium heat is best. Too hot, and burgers burn on the outside before getting done on the inside.
- Clean Your Grill. Always start with a clean, oiled grill grate. This keeps burgers from sticking, extends the life of your grate, and helps put those beautiful grill marks on your patties.
- Turn Once and Don't Smash. It's hard to resist, but do not flatten your burgers with the spatula. It squeezes out flavorful juices.
- Cook Thoroughly. How long to grill hamburgers? Cook ground beef to an internal temperature of 160 degrees F (170 degrees F for poultry). For an accurate reading, insert the thermometer into the patty horizontally.
